📦Storage Boxes & Baskets: Hide the Chaos
Let’s be real—outdoor spaces get messy. Enter storage boxes and baskets, the unsung heroes of tidiness. Modular furniture often comes with built-in storage, like ottomans that open to stash cushions or tables with hidden compartments. I tossed a wicker basket under my modular coffee table, and now my throws and magazines have a home that’s both chic and sneaky. Decorate these baskets with candle holders or small vases for extra flair. Once, I caught my dog napping in one—proof they’re cozy enough for everyone. Use them to store gardening tools or kids’ toys, keeping your patio pristine.

⚡Pro Tips for Maximum Wow
- 🌟Mix textures: Pair sleek modular pieces with rustic planters or woven baskets.
- 🎨Play with color: Bright cushions on neutral furniture make decor like vases pop.
- 🔄Rearrange often: Modular furniture’s meant to move, so experiment weekly.
- 💡Add lighting: String lights or solar lanterns enhance candles and mirrors.
